iPhone 15 Plus
The large, long-lasting standard iPhone — Dynamic Island, 48 MP camera and USB-C — for buyers who want size over telephoto zoom.
iPhone 15 Plus: key facts
When was the iPhone 15 Plus released?
The iPhone 15 Plus was released in September 22, 2023.
How much did the iPhone 15 Plus cost?
The iPhone 15 Plus launched at $899 in 2023 — about $926 in today’s money (approximate, US CPI).
What are the iPhone 15 Plus’s specs?
The iPhone 15 Plus used a Apple A16 Bionic running at 3.46 GHz, with 6 GB of memory and 128 GB of storage. It ran iOS 17.
Why does the iPhone 15 Plus matter?
Big-screen non-Pro iPhone with USB-C and Dynamic Island.
Full specifications
| CPU | Apple A16 Bionic · 3.46 GHz |
|---|---|
| Cores | 6 |
| Memory (RAM) | 6 GB |
| Storage | 128 GB |
| Display | 6.7" Super Retina XDR OLED, 2796×1290 |
| GPU | Apple 5-core GPU |
| Ports | USB-C |
| Weight | 201 g |
| Dimensions | 160.9×77.8×7.8 mm |
| Operating system | iOS 17 |
| Released | September 22, 2023 |
| Discontinued | — |
| Launch price | $899 |
